It's possible to drain the poison from the room. There's a windmill near (I think the first) bonfire of the area. If you hit it with your torch to set it ablaze, the poison will drain out of the room. For some reason.

You now need to mash the action button (A on 360, X on ps3) to find most hidden doors. Hitting them with your weapon doesn't do anything.

Regarding early weapons -- you can buy a nice variety from the first blacksmith. Axes, swords, bow, spear.

Cool melee weapons - watch out for the Twinblades. Also some of the Greatswords have funky animations, like the Royal Swordsman Greatsword.

What is your equipment load looking like? I had to downgrade to Leather to be able to move fast enough to get to the Ballista before Pursuer could (He's good at pursuing people. Who would have thought?)

If it helps any, I stood in the corner of the room and waited for him to float up in front of me, then pull his sword back to charge. As soon as he did that, rolled past his charge and sprinted to the Ballista, primed it, then shot him in the face while he was about two feet away from the thing.

Also, I'd suggest using the one on the left. The one on the right is too far away and positioned poorly.
